Instant Messaging is some of the widespread types of digital communication. You do not need to pay further charges (not counting information fees) for chatting with relations, pals or colleagues no matter their location.
But, there was a rising concern in regards to the privateness of such companies. State-sponsored assaults and mass surveillance are some main examples.
Tox is a peer-to-peer instant messaging protocol with end-to-end encryption for Windows, Linux, macOS, Android and iOS.
What is a decentralized messenger?
Let me clarify what a centralized messaging service is. Any instant messaging protocol that makes use of a cloud-based connection, aka a server, is a centralized service. Examples for this may be Skype, Hangouts, Facebook Messenger, Viber or Telegram. When you ship a message by means of a centralized service, it is transmitted (passes by means of) a server, the place it might or will not be saved earlier than it is delivered to the recipient. This might probably end in information being stolen, or the person being spied on.
A decentralized messenger is one which cuts out the intermediary, i.e., there is no server in between you and your contact. The message that you just ship is delivered on to the recipient, as in Peer-to-Peer (P2P). Combined with end-to-end encryption; this is higher for privateness when in comparison with a centralized service.
Tox encryption and Security
Tox makes use of NaCl encryption for cryptography and the builders have labelled this as experimental. The encryption occurs on a per-message foundation. Also, price mentioning is that messages are metadata free, which is necessary as a result of metadata is used as a approach to hint customers. Your information is solely saved in your gadget.
Is Tox safe?
The primary concern with Tox is that regardless of being open supply, its encryption protocol has not been audited. The builders do not conceal this although and have clearly talked about this on the official web site, which is a good signal. Does Tox expose the IP tackle? Any P2P service will, that is how they work. Tox does through the use of your IP and your contact’s that will help you talk with each other instantly. You might strive utilizing it with Tor or a VPN to stop this.
Note: Your IP tackle is solely seen to folks whom you add as contacts, different customers cannot see it. I strongly advise you to learn the service’s documentation earlier than utilizing it.
There are many consumers out there for Tox. The hottest desktop functions are uTox and qTox. The official cell apps whereas outdated nonetheless work. I additionally examined Tok Lite (would not assist calls), which is a fork of the official Antox Android app.
Signing up for Tox
There is no registration required as there is no account. When you put in a Tox shopper and run it, you will notice that it has a Tox ID (lengthy alphanumerical ID) that is prepared to make use of. You can change your title to no matter you need to. One of the most important benefits of Tox is that you just needn’t present a telephone quantity or an e-mail tackle.
I put in uTox on my laptop (set it up) and then put in qTox; it routinely picked up my Tox profile. That’s as a result of Tox saves a profile to the AppDataRoamingTox folder. You will see a .Tox file right here, this is your Tox profile. You can use it to export your profile to different units, for e.g. if you wish to import it to the cell app.
There are a couple of how to do that. You can ship your Tox ID to somebody to ask them to talk. They have to simply accept your request and optionally add you as a contact. Or you possibly can ship your QR code that they’ll scan to simply accept your invite (solely on cell apps). Some shoppers have extra performance corresponding to an choice to ship voice messages, seize a screenshot of a chosen area on the display and ship it to the contact.
Messages, Voice Calls and Video Calls
Tox permits you to ship instant messages to your contacts, however may also be used to make audio calls, and video calls. All communication made by means of Tox is end-to-end encrypted. The Mobile shoppers show notifications and perform similar to most IM apps.
You can ship recordsdata to your contact and relying on the shopper that you just’re utilizing, you can select whether or not to simply accept the incoming switch or reject it. This choice may also be helpful to avoid wasting information, if you happen to’re on a cell community.
Since every thing is peer-to-peer primarily based, the connection velocity is determined by the community high quality of you and your contact. It labored flawlessly on native networks, cell networks, and long-distance peer-to-peer communication as nicely. I used IPv6, however it additionally works with IPv4 networks.
The primary problem with the service is in all probability getting folks to make use of it.
Before I wrote this put up, I used to be utilizing Jami (previously Ring) for a few days. It had method too many connectivity points (could not ship messages, unjoinable peer, and so forth), that I needed to ditch it. Maybe you’ll have higher luck with it. Wire was once good, till it was acquired quietly (went from a Luxembourg primarily based possession to a US one). It has been criticized by Edward Snowden. Riot is an alternative choice, although it makes use of Matrix (which has been hacked twice iirc). Signal nonetheless appears to be the perfect safe messaging app, however it requires a telephone quantity. Android customers can strive Briar, which makes use of Tor (for web) or Bluetooth/Wi-Fi.